The core mechanism behind "Ozempic face" is the body's response to significant and quick fat reduction. When substantial fat loss occurs rapidly, especially from the face and neck, the underlying fat compartments that provide structure and volume diminish. This loss of subcutaneous fat can lead to a gaunt or hollowed-out look, making the skin appear looser. Contributing factors include poor skin elasticity, which is the skin's ability to snap back after being stretchedSemaglutide and the skin: A brief review of dermatologic .... As we age, skin elasticity naturally decreases, making it more susceptible to sagging when faced with significant volume loss. Therefore, the combination of rapid weight loss and age-related changes can exacerbate the effect, giving an appearance of accelerated facial aging.“Ozempic Face” After GLP-1 Weight Loss: Why Fat Transfer ...
The areas most commonly affected are the cheeks, temples, under-eyes, and the jawline, leading to a less defined profile. For individuals already experiencing these effects, various treatment options are available:
* Minimally Invasive Treatments: To combat facial hollowing and sagging skin, minimally invasive procedures can be highly effectiveSemaglutide “Ozempic” Face and Implications in Cosmetic Dermatology. Dermal fillers, such as hyaluronic acid-based fillers, can be strategically injected to restore lost volume in the cheeks, temples, and under-eyes, thereby plumping the skin and softening lines.作者:G Daneshgaran·2025·被引用次数:4—The term “Ozempic® face” has been coined to describe the exaggerated volumelossfromsemaglutidetherapy, resulting in advanced facial aging. Treatments like Sculptra and Profhilo are designed to stimulate collagen production, which can improve skin texture and elasticity over time, offering a more natural-looking rejuvenation2026年1月29日—Often referred to as “Ozempic face,” this effect occurs when significantfat lossimpacts facial volume, skin elasticity, and overall structure, .... These treatments can effectively restore youthful contours and address the jawline definition.
* Skin Tightening Procedures: Advanced skin tightening treatments can also significantly improve the appearance of loose skin. Technologies like radiofrequency and ultrasound therapies work by delivering energy to the deeper layers of the skin, stimulating collagen and elastin production, leading to firmer and tighter skin.'Ozempic Face': What It Is and How to Avoid It These non-invasive methods are particularly useful for addressing laxity in the jawline and neck.
* Fat Transfer: In some cases, a fat transfer procedure, where a patient's own fat is harvested from one area of the body and reinjected into the face, can provide a more permanent solution for restoring lost volume. This method can effectively rebuild facial structure that has been diminished by rapid weight loss'Ozempic Face': What It Is and How to Avoid It.
* Surgical Interventions: For more pronounced cases of skin laxity, surgical options such as facelifts or neck lifts may be considered to remove excess skin and reposition underlying tissues, offering a more dramatic and immediate lift to the sagging areas.Semaglutide and Non-Invasive Skin Tightening After ...
